A Day Out – A Wonderful Day With Good Weather

A real wonderful day out at the National Memorial Arboretum near Lichfield.
See History Click Here

The British Merchant Navy is very well supported and some 2535 Oak Trees that have been planted, one for every Merchant Ship and Fishing Vessel lost during the 2nd World War.

A wonderful memorial and tribute to all armed and supporting services during many campaigns.

A Powerful and Moving Look At The Aftermath of A Fatal Collision

Fatal collisions are an all-too-common tragedy on the county’s roads.

But how are they dealt with by police and what is the impact on those nearest and dearest to the victims?

A podcast that answers those questions has received nearly 2,000 listens since it was released as part of our Cambs Cops: Our Stories series in August.

It sets the words of experienced road policing officer Mark Dollard alongside those of Claire Danks, whose 22-year-old daughter Lauren was killed in an horrific crash caused by a drink driver in 2016.

Mark explains the mental processes that allow him take the emotion and confusion out of what can be devastating scenes, while Claire bravely recollects the moments when she first became aware something wasn’t right.

She goes on to speak movingly about the impact of the loss, which felt like someone “dropping a bomb” on her family. And she makes a heartfelt plea to anyone else considering getting behind the wheel while over the limit.
